Embryonic Development Inside the Egg
As you hold the delicate mallard duck egg in your hands, it’s hard to imagine the intricate processes happening inside. But trust us, embryonic development is a remarkable journey that sets the stage for life outside the shell. At around 3-4 days into incubation, the embryo begins to develop a primitive streak, which will eventually give rise to all major organs and tissues.
As the embryo grows, it undergoes a series of critical milestones. By day 5-6, the heart starts beating, pumping blood through its primitive vessels. This is an essential step in establishing circulation and preparing for life outside the egg. Around this time, the limb buds begin to form, eventually giving rise to wings, legs, and webbed feet – all uniquely adapted for a waterfowl lifestyle.
By day 12-13, the duckling’s major organs are formed, including lungs, liver, and digestive system. The beak begins to take shape, and eyes start to develop their distinctive yellow coloration. This is an exciting time in embryonic development, as all systems come online, preparing for the dramatic transition from egg to waterborne world.
Hatching and Emergence
As the incubation period comes to an end, mallard ducklings are ready to emerge from their eggs. This process is a remarkable display of resilience and adaptability. As they prepare to break free, you’ll notice physical changes occurring within the egg.
The first sign of emergence is the pecking at the air cells in the egg, which helps to weaken the shell. Once the membrane surrounding the beak is pierced, the duckling will begin to pip – a small opening through which it can breathe and expand its chest. With each passing minute, the pipping process accelerates, eventually leading to a full breach of the eggshell.
As the first ducklings emerge, they’ll look rather bedraggled, with soft, downy feathers and closed eyes. They’ll be around 4-5 inches long, weighing about an ounce or so. During this initial period outside the egg, they rely on their yolk sac for nutrition, which can take up to 24 hours to dissipate completely.

Broodling and Early Weaning
As mallard ducklings emerge from their eggs, they rely heavily on their mother’s care for survival. This critical period is known as brooding, where the female duck devotes herself to feeding, protecting, and keeping her young warm. During this time, she will often settle into a sheltered spot, such as a nest or a thicket, to ensure her ducklings’ safety.
A healthy mother mallard will produce an average of 9-12 eggs per clutch, with incubation lasting approximately 28 days. After hatching, the ducklings are covered in soft, downy feathers and weigh about one ounce each. The mother’s broodling process typically lasts for several weeks, during which she regulates her ducklings’ body temperature to around 98°F (36.7°C), providing them with essential warmth.
As the ducklings grow, their mother gradually introduces them to aquatic plants and insects as a food source. By the time they’re about two weeks old, most young mallards have transitioned to eating small invertebrates like snails or worms. This gradual introduction is crucial for their digestive health and prevents any adverse reactions to novel foods.
Feeding Habits and Dietary Requirements
As mallard ducklings grow and develop, their dietary needs change rapidly. In the wild, they feed on a variety of foods including aquatic plants, insects, small crustaceans, and even tiny fish. At around 10-14 days old, they begin to follow their mother’s foraging habits closely, learning which plants are safe to eat and how to extract nutrients from them.
To replicate these conditions in captivity, human caregivers can provide a varied diet that includes a mix of aquatic plants, commercial duck pellets or crumbles, and live or frozen insects. It’s essential to ensure the water is clean and free of contaminants to prevent digestive issues. A good rule of thumb is to offer a variety of foods at different times of day, mimicking the natural foraging process.
For example, you can offer a handful of aquatic plants in the morning, followed by live or frozen insects in the afternoon. Supplementing with commercial duck food will provide essential nutrients and support rapid growth.

Predator Avoidance and Defense Mechanisms
Mallard ducklings have an incredible array of defense strategies to protect themselves from predators. One of their most effective tactics is group behavior – they almost always stay together, even when foraging or exploring new areas. This “safety in numbers” approach makes it much harder for predators like foxes, coyotes, and hawks to single out individual ducklings.
Another clever defense mechanism employed by mallard ducklings is camouflage. They’re experts at hiding in vegetation, often blending seamlessly into the surrounding landscape. By staying low to the ground and using their brownish-gray plumage to merge with the foliage, they become nearly invisible to predators.
In addition to these passive defenses, mallard ducklings also have a highly effective alarm call system. When one duckling spots a predator, it will let out a loud, high-pitched call that alerts other ducks in the area to potential danger. This warning system allows nearby ducklings to scurry for cover and avoid becoming prey.
By employing these various defense strategies, mallard ducklings are able to significantly reduce their vulnerability to predators – an essential adaptation given the dangers they face from birth.

Habitat Destruction and Pollution Impact
Habitat destruction and pollution are significant threats to mallard duckling populations. As urbanization continues to expand, natural habitats such as wetlands and grasslands are being converted into residential areas, commercial spaces, and agricultural land. This loss of habitat not only reduces the availability of food and shelter for mallards but also disrupts their migratory patterns.
Pollution from human activities is another major concern. Runoff from agricultural fields and urban streets carries fertilizers, pesticides, and other pollutants that contaminate water sources. When mallard ducklings ingest these pollutants through their diet or contact them directly, it can lead to reproductive problems, reduced growth rates, and increased mortality.
